Inflation And Real Income Of Households In View Of Public - January 2013
Červenka, Jan
Two thirds (68%) of people believe that for the income of their household they can buy or pay less than a year ago, 26% believe that the real income of their households is about the same as a year before, and only 4% of respondents said that their real income during the last year has increased.

Citizens on Economic Situation of the Czech Republic and Living Standard of Their Households - October 2012
Červenka, Jan
According to the October survey of CVVM, 69% of people evaluate the current economic situation in the Czech Republic as bad, 25% view it as neither good nor bad and 5% consider it to be good. 34% of Czechs evaluate the living standard of their household as good, 26% consider it to be bad, and 40% characterize it as neither good, nor bad.

Public opinion on the role of churches in the society and on the restitution of church property
Ďurďovič, Martin
September's survey of CVVM comprised a question regarding the role of church in the society and a set of questions concerning the topic of church restitution. On the one hand, the presented press release contains information on to what extent citizens are interested in the problem of church restitution and to what extent they agree with the current proposal of property compensations toward churches. On the other hand, it analyses in detail, what is the public opinion on the range of these compensations and it also follows up, what attitudes citizens take toward different key aspects of church restitution, as they unfolded in the existing debate. It turned out that Czechs consider churches to be desirable most importantly for granting of spiritual support to people and for performing of charity. But only about one sixth of the public subscribes to the current proposal of church property compensations.

Citizens on Opportunities to Receive Education and Tuition Fees - September 2012
Červenka, Jan
In September survey 59% of respondents expressed their opinion that everybody has a chance to get such education according to his or her abilities. Then respondents had to answer a question, what circumstances and various facts influence educational background. Respondents often suppose human abilities, diligence and desire for education to be important, when trying to get higher education. Only 21% of Czechs think that paying of tuition fees on the public universities should be introduced, 73% of citizens refuses this idea.

Citizens on Economic Situation of the Czech Republic and Living Standard of Their Households - September 2012
Červenka, Jan
According to the September survey of CVVM, 70% of people evaluate the current economic situation in the Czech Republic as bad, 23% view it as neither good nor bad and 6% consider it to be good. 37% of Czechs evaluate the living standard of their household as good, 23% consider it to be bad, and 40% characterize it as neither good, nor bad.
